Chloroflexusaurantiacus - thermophilic photosynthetic bacterium (affiliated to Thermus-group) - isolated from a Yellowstone Park hot spring - earliest branching phototroph in standard ssu rRNA-trees - genome sequenced no bc-complex in Chloroflexus (genome), sole Rieske protein in the arsenite oxidase operon Inital results: - Rieske protein is membrane-associated (no RPE signal in supernatant) - Rieske protein can be light-oxidised, i.e. electrons from AsIII oxidation enter the photosynthetic electron transfer chain
